Antique furniture repair services involve the restoration and preservation of older, often valuable pieces to maintain their historical integrity and aesthetic appeal. These services typically address issues such as scratches, chips, cracks, loose joints, and worn finishes. Skilled technicians assess the condition of each item and utilize specialized techniques to repair damage, reinforce structural stability, and restore original finishes or apply new ones that match the piece’s vintage look. The goal is to enhance the durability and appearance of antique furniture while respecting its unique character and craftsmanship.

Many common problems encountered in antique furniture repair include wood warping, veneer lifting, missing or broken parts, and surface deterioration. Over time, exposure to environmental factors and regular use can cause these issues, diminishing the piece’s value and functionality. Repair professionals work carefully to address these concerns, often employing traditional methods alongside modern techniques to ensure authenticity. Their expertise helps prevent further damage and extends the lifespan of treasured furniture pieces, allowing them to be enjoyed for generations.

The overview below groups typical Antique Furniture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Buda, TX.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Furniture Repair Costs - The typical cost for antique furniture repair ranges from $150 to $600, depending on the extent of damage and the type of wood involved. Smaller touch-ups or minor repairs may be closer to the lower end of this range, while extensive restoration can approach higher prices.

Refinishing and Restoration - Refinishing antique pieces generally costs between $300 and $1,200, influenced by size and complexity. Restoring a heavily damaged antique can increase costs, especially if custom matching finishes are required.

Veneer Repair - Veneer repair services usually fall within the $100 to $400 range, depending on the size of the affected area and the veneer type. Small repairs might be on the lower end, while larger sections or intricate patterns can cost more.

Upholstery and Cushion Work - Upholstery services for antique furniture typically range from $200 to $800, with costs varying based on fabric choice and furniture size. Replacing or repairing cushions may add to the overall expense, especially for high-quality materials.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
